How much do wire operator j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for wire operator in the United States is $24.46,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.43 and $30.05 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Position Summary

The EDM Wire Operator is responsible for setting up, programming, and operating Wire EDM equipment to produce precision tooling and components to print. This role requires strong blueprint reading sk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ently while maintaining tight tolerances in a tool room environment.


Essential Duties & Responsibilities
  • Set up, program, and operate Wire EDM machines to manufacture precision tooling and components
  • Interpret engineering drawings, prints, and GD&T to ensure dimensional accuracy and surface finish requirements
  • Create, modify, and optimize EDM programs using CAD/CAM or machinebased programming
  • Select appropriate wire, offsets, skim passes, taper controls, and flushing parameters
  • Inspect parts using precision measuring equipment and maintain accurate documentation
  • Troubleshoot wire breaks, taper errors, flushing issues, and surface finish concerns
  • Perform routine EDM machine maintenance (wire, filters, resin, conductivity)
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ment
  • Follow all company safety rules, quality standards, and policies
  • Communicate effectively with supervisors, quality, and tool room team members

Qualifications
  • High school diploma or GED required
  • 2+ years of Wire EDM experience in a manufacturing or tool room environment preferred
  • Strong ability to read prints and apply GD&T
  • Experience with EDM programming (CAD/CAM or conversational)
  • Familiarity with tool steels, stainless steel, aluminum, and/or carbide
  • Experience with EDM equipment such as Makino, Mitsubishi, Sodick, Fanuc, or similar preferred
  • Ability to work independently and troubleshoot machining issues
  • Strong mechanical aptitude and attention to detail
